Kafka簡介及使用PHP處理Kafka消息 Kafka 是一種高吞吐的分布式消息系統,能夠替代傳統的消息隊列用於解耦合數據處理,緩存未處理消息等,同時具有更高的吞吐率,支持分區、多副本、冗余,因此被廣泛用於大規模消息數據處理應用。 Kafka的特點: 以時間復雜度為O ...
Kafka簡介及使用PHP處理Kafka消息 Kafka 是一種高吞吐的分布式消息系統,能夠替代傳統的消息隊列用於解耦合數據處理,緩存未處理消息等,同時具有更高的吞吐率,支持分區、多副本、冗余,因此被廣泛用於大規模消息數據處理應用。 Kafka的特點: 以時間復雜度為O ...
話說用了就要有點產出,要不然過段時間又忘了,所以在這里就記錄一下試用Kafka的安裝過程和php擴展的試用。 實話說,如果用於隊列的話,跟PHP比較配的,還是Redis。用的順手,呵呵,只是Redis不能有多個consumer。但Kafka官方對PHP不支持,PHP擴展是愛好者或使用者寫的。下面 ...
2020-9-7 14:18:37 星期一 PHP官方的kafka擴展是 rdkafka; kafka PHP官方擴展文檔: https://arnaud.le-blanc.net/php-rdkafka-doc/phpdoc/book.rdkafka.htmlkafka 配置項的官方說明 ...
安裝 Kafka 服務 直接到 kafka 官網 , 下載最新的 wget https://mirror.bit.edu.cn/apache/kafka/2.5.0/kafka_2.13-2.5.0.tgz 解壓,進入目錄 tar ...
Kafka-php-使用 PHP 編寫的 Kafka 客戶端 一. 首先確認下jdk有沒有安裝 使用命令 如果有以上信息的話,就往下安裝吧,有些可能是jdk對不上,那就裝到對的上的。如果沒有安裝,就看一下下面的jdk安裝方法 ...
最近項目開發中需要使用 Kafka 消息隊列。經過檢索,PHP下面有通用的兩種方式來調用 Kafka 。 php-rdkafka 擴展 以 PHP 擴展的形式進行使用是非常高效的。另外,該項目也提供了非常完備的 文檔 。 不過在 Mac 環境中安裝的過程中出現了以下報錯: 開始以為是 ...
簡單測試 環境:Centos6.4,PHP7,kafka服務器IP:192.168.9.154,PHP服務器:192.168.9.157 在192.168.9.157創建目錄和文件。 記住消費者PHP文件要在終端運行:php consumer.php ...
Centos版本:Centos6.4,PHP版本:PHP7。 在上一篇文章中使用IP為192.168.9.154的機器安裝並開啟了Kafka進行了簡單測試,充當了Kafka服務器。 本篇文章新開啟一台IP為192.16.9.157的機器給PHP開啟擴展。 找到github的擴展下載地址 ...